Stagecoach is encouraging customers across Aberdeen and Aberdeenshire to travel to the airport by bus this Easter, using the service 727 direct service to Aberdeen International Airport.
Running up to every 15 minutes, seven days a week, the service 727 provides a fast, reliable link from Aberdeen city centre, dropping passengers off directly outside the main terminal. As the airport sits within the Aberdeen city boundary, all Aberdeen City Zone tickets can be used on the service.
A DayRider ticket is available for £4.80, while an Adult 727 Period Return costs £9.20 and is valid for one journey in each direction within 28 days. Under-22s and Over-60s travel free with a National Entitlement Card.
Aberdeen International Airport plays a vital role in connecting the North of Scotland with key European destinations, and the service 727 offers a convenient, affordable and sustainable way to reach the terminal.
